As you know, Resident Evil: The Mercenaries 3D only has one save slot, and it cannot be deleted. This has caused many gamers to be absolutely furious as a result, especially those who want to sell or give away games that they have already completed. Or those who, like me, play afresh every now and then.
Even though Capcom has officially said that this was not intended to curb used game sales, they also said that it was the most sensible option for a game like The Mercenaries. Bull. However, they did say that the controversy of it is enough for them to not use it in future titles.
In the latest Ask Capcom, Christian Svensson said “I think it’s fair to say there was never quite the malicious intent the conspiracy theorists out there would have you believe, It’s also fair to say in light of the controversy it’s generated I don’t think you’re going to see something like this happening again.” in the video interview.
